Ticket: Move Quillgate's packaging pipeline onto the Hermitbuild hermetic toolchain. Right now the legacy scripts pull compilers off whatever's on the runner, which is... not great for provenance. Migration pins every toolchain input by digest and drops network access during compile. Security angle: reproducible outputs mean we can finally diff suspicious artifacts. One flaky codegen step remains. Repro details are keyed to the build stamp below.

pipeline stamp: htk9_ce63042d9

Step 4: Swap profiler backends

Replace all VramScope imports with the new GlintProfiler API. Allocation hooks now register at context creation, not per-kernel. Verify the reviewer checklist: no legacy sampler flags, histogram bins set to 256, and export interval under 5s. Profiler traces persist to the metrics store; confirm writes land by connecting with the string below.

replica DSN, yahog-kawig: redis://istox_svc:um@db-8a67.halixforge.test:5432/frawyn

Downstream services (Orrery, Plinth, and the billing shim) still emit spans, but cross-service correlation is blind until the vault reopens. Do not restart the collector; that discards the in-memory span buffer. Instead, unseal the vault from the recovery console, verify the keyring version matches the rotation log, and confirm spans resume flowing. Unsealing requires the recovery passphrase, which is provided below.

strongbox words: zorwyn-sorael-belion-ulaius-silmir-ulays-briax-rusdor-gorix

## Runbook: Tailing with spyglass

For release-window monitoring, use the spyglass CLI rather than raw node access. It multiplexes streams from all pods in a deployment and applies redaction rules before anything hits your terminal. Start a tail before the deploy begins and keep it running through the bake period; if output stalls for more than a minute, escalate. Spyglass reads its runtime settings from the block below.

config for bawig-fadup:
[zorix]
host = zorix.lumicworks.corp
user = zorix_svc
database = zorix_prod